Pursuit of Athletic Excellence Grant

Gant details:

  •  This grant is available to AOA resident members who travel out-of-province to participate in major "A" orienteering events: eg: COC, WCOC, NAOC, WMOC, non-Alberta provincial Champioships (must be "A" level and other (enquire with AOA office)
  • This Grant is also available to AOA resident members who travel out-of-province to officiate in the "A" level orienteering events listed above: eg: Meet Director, Controller at the 300 level of the new COF officials Program, and other (enwuire with AOA office.
  • The AOA members resident who travel out-of-province to participate in orienteering training camp can also be eligible for this grant.

Requirements for applications for the Pursuit of Athletic Excellence grant:

     

  • applicants must be AOA members in good standing
  • applicants must be Alberta residents for the 12 past months prior to the event
  • no receipts are required, event results will be checked on-line by the AOA
  • applicants need to apply with the correct form and respect the deadline
  • the AOA office will be sending an email out to inform the members of the date and it will also be posted on the website

    Grant Amount:

  • $100 for western Canada - BC, SK, MB
  • $200 for the rest of Canada
  • $300 for International, including the United States

Note: The amount of the Grant will be pro-rated among the applicants should the grant budget maximum be reached.

Orienteering Learning and Development Grant

  • This grant is available to AOA residents members who attend Officials courses, Coaching courses, Orienteering workshops, Conferences etc.
  • There is no out-of-province travel restriction on this grant
  • course fees and travel costs will be reimbursed up to a total of $250 or pro-rated among the applicants should the grant budget be reached.
  • Receipts need to be provided

In order to apply for the Orienteering Learning and development grant: 

  • Applicants must be a AOA members in good standing
  • Applicants must be Alberta residents for the past 12 months prior to funding
  • applicants need to apply with the correct form and respect the deadline, the AOA office will be sending out an email to inform members of the date and it will also be posted on the website.

The AOA Board reserves the right to approve or reject Pursuit of Athletic Excellence and the Orienteering Learning and Development grants requests based on the judged merit of the activity/event being applied for.

The Board may decide to substitute a special grant in lieu of the Pursuit of Athletic Excellence grant in certain special cases
